Liye Liu is a scholar working on Pulmonary and Respiratory Medicine, Surgery and Control and Systems Engineering. According to data from OpenAlex, Liye Liu has authored 46 papers receiving a total of 397 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Pulmonary and Respiratory Medicine, 9 papers in Surgery and 9 papers in Control and Systems Engineering. Recurrent topics in Liye Liu's work include Advanced Control Systems Design (6 papers), Gastric Cancer Management and Outcomes (4 papers) and Advanced X-ray and CT Imaging (4 papers). Liye Liu is often cited by papers focused on Advanced Control Systems Design (6 papers), Gastric Cancer Management and Outcomes (4 papers) and Advanced X-ray and CT Imaging (4 papers). Liye Liu collaborates with scholars based in China, United States and France. Liye Liu's co-authors include Qibing Jin, Binquan Zhang, Lijun Tang, Weihui Liu, Junli Li, L. de Carlan, Didier Franck, Hao Luo, Vera Usuelli and Rui Qiu and has published in prestigious journals such as PLoS ONE, Critical Care Medicine and The Journal of Physical Chemistry Letters.
